Abstract

This study aims to analyze the hadith about stock investment in Islam. This study uses a qualitative approach that emphasizes literature study through the takhrij and syarah hadith methods with contemporary analysis. The results of this study found that the quality status of the investment hadith was assessed as hasan li ghairihi, in the sense of maqbul and ma'mul bih for Muslim practice. The conclusion of this study is that the hadith of the Prophet Muhammad regarding stock investment in Islam is a recommended activity, because investment activities have been carried out by the Prophet Muhammad since he was young until before the apostleship. Unless prohibited activities are found in investment activities, both objects and procedures, the investment is prohibited. This study recommends that further research be carried out through collaboration between enthusiasts of hadith science and business economics to research related to stock investment in terms of objects and processes if you want to invest in stocks in accordance with Islamic teachings.
